Earnings, virus news to dictate direction of stock prices
US stocks rose slightly last week as a vaccine breakthrough boosted hopes that the world could return to normal.
The gains could moderate this week if earnings reports are as dire as anticipated and Covid-19 outbreaks in the US sun belt become deadlier.
Shares of Moderna surged after the biotech company, which has never succeeded in bringing a drug to market, said that its experimental, RNA-based vaccine showed impressive levels of efficacy in a mid-stage clinical trial.
